Biometric Inverse Problems: A Comprehensive Guide
Biometric inverse problems are a type of mathematical problem that arises in the field of biometrics. Biometrics is the study of using unique physical or behavioral characteristics to identify individuals. Biometric inverse problems involve using these characteristics to reconstruct an individual's identity.

Biometric inverse problems are typically solved using image processing and pattern recognition techniques. These techniques can be used to extract features from biometric data, such as fingerprints, facial images, and iris scans. These features can then be used to reconstruct an individual's identity using a variety of mathematical models.
Biometric inverse problems have a wide range of applications, including:
- Identity verification
- Person identification
- Forensics
- Medical diagnosis
- Biometric security
